48140 ZIP Code — Ida, MI

Monroe County, Michigan

ZIP code 48140 is located in Ida, Michigan, within Monroe County. It covers approximately 26.35 square miles and serves a population of 3,414 residents. This is a standard ZIP code in the Eastern (ET) timezone, served by area code 734.

About ZIP code 48140

The housing stock consists of predominantly single-family detached homes. Most homes were built in the 1970s, giving the area an established character. Median home value is $240,800. Owner-occupancy is high at 93%, well above the national average.

Median household income is $103,611. The poverty rate of 4% is below the national average.

The dominant occupation class is management, business, and professional, with education and healthcare as the leading industry. The average commute of 32 minutes is near the national average.

Educational attainment is near the national average, with 22% of residents holding a bachelor's degree or higher.
